Wildlife Encounters

While the main goal is spotting the famous Yala leopards, the tour also guarantees sightings of elephants, crocodiles, wild boars, spotted deer, and other mammals. Reviewers mention the “main goal” of seeing leopard cats, which adds a sense of purpose to the trip.

Beyond the big cats, expect to observe a broad variety of birds—from eagles and peacocks to kingfishers and hornbills—as well as reptiles like snakes and land monitor lizards. Visitors frequently comment on the diversity of wildlife, which makes each safari unique.

Park Entry and Additional Costs

Note that Yala’s entry fee (~12,000 LKR per person) is not included in the tour price, so budget accordingly. The tour includes hotel pick-up from Tissamaharama, Kataragama, Kirinda, Palatupana, Debarawewa, Weerawila, and Yodakandiya—making it convenient no matter where you stay.
